Howden Africa Businesses

The Howden Africa group of companies have proven engineering expertise, SABS ISO 9001 certified quality management systems, and complete professional support from conceptualisation to commissioning of a variety of products and systems.

Bateman Howden South Africa helps enable the South African power generation industry to meet its emissions obligations cost effectively.

Howden Donkin specializes in the design, manufacture and supply of standard and pre-engineered fans, blowers and accessories.

Howden Energy Systems supplies combustion systems, industrial heat treatment furnaces, incinerators, cooling and refrigeration plants, air pollution control equipment and electrical/electronic control and instrumentation.

Howden Fan Equipment (which incorporates Howden Safanco and Engart Africa) designs, manufactures and maintains fans for mining and industrial clients. The company provides all products, systems and support needed for efficient fan operation.

Howden Power specialises in the design, manufacture, supply, installation and maintenance of boiler fans and rotary regenerative air pre-heaters (airheaters) for the power generation, petrochemical, sugar and paper industries.


Howden Launch Training Academy

Howden has partnered with Glasgow Caledonian University to create Howden Academy – a new international post graduate programme based at the university which will deliver specialist operational training to hundreds of Howden’s engineering graduates from 16 countries over the next few years.
